Miami, FL Apartments for Rent

Miami shines as Florida's second-largest city and a major international hub for finance, commerce, and culture, where the downtown skyline ranks as the third-tallest in the United States alongside the scenic Biscayne Bay. If you're searching for apartments for rent in Miami, you'll discover a varied rental market stretching from high-rise apartment communities in the financial district of Brickell to budget-friendly options in neighborhoods like Little Havana and Coconut Grove, with average rents running from about $2,088 for studios to $2,763 for two-bedroom units.

Renting in Miami makes sense for savvy renters thanks to the city's robust job market in finance, international trade, and tourism, plus easy access to major universities like Florida International University and the University of Miami. The city delivers solid transportation options including the Metrorail, Metromover, and convenient connections to Miami International Airport, while sought-after neighborhoods like Wynwood bring an artistic vibe, Midtown serves up dining and nightlife along Biscayne Boulevard, and areas near the Metrorail line keep your commute simple. Residents soak up year-round warm weather, nearby beaches in Miami Beach and Key Biscayne, plus cultural spots like the Perez Art Museum and entertainment at LoanDepot Park for Marlins games.
